Understanding the Causes of Uneven Concrete



Unequal concrete surfaces can commonly be traced back to a number of underlying causes. One usual variable is soil settlement, which takes place as the ground beneath the concrete shifts or presses in time. This can result from inappropriate compaction throughout the initial installment or adjustments in wetness levels. Another adding element is tree roots, which can expand beneath concrete pieces, pushing them upwards and creating disproportion. Furthermore, freeze-thaw cycles can cause heaving, as water infiltrates cracks and increases when frozen. Poor drainage can intensify these concerns, enabling water to swimming pool and deteriorate the dirt underneath the surface area. Understanding these variables is necessary for home owners looking for to attend to and remedy the disproportion in their concrete structures successfully.

Signs of Unequal Surface Areas



A recognizable shift in the surface of concrete can cause numerous concerns, making it important to acknowledge the signs that indicate a demand for leveling. One usual indicator is the visibility of splits, which may show up as small crevices or bigger voids. In addition, irregular surface areas often lead to pooling water, developing a risk throughout rainfall or snow. Homeowners may also observe a noticeable slope or dip in the concrete, influencing aesthetic appeals and functionality. Another indicator is the sound produced when walking on the surface area; hollow or resembling noises can signify spaces underneath. Routine inspection for these signs can assist stop additionally wear and tear, guaranteeing a safe and secure concrete surface area for years ahead

Picking the Right Leveling Method: Mudjacking vs. Polyurethane



Picking the ideal leveling approach is vital to attaining lasting outcomes. 2 usual strategies are mudjacking and polyurethane foam shot. Mudjacking includes pumping a cement-based blend under the concrete slab to lift it back to its initial setting. This approach is frequently economical and appropriate for larger projects but can be heavier and more time-consuming. In comparison, polyurethane foam shot utilizes light-weight foam to lift and maintain the concrete. This approach uses much faster treating times and marginal disruption but may come at a higher price. Inevitably, the option between mudjacking and polyurethane depends on particular job demands, including budget plan, soil conditions, and the size of the location requiring leveling, guaranteeing resilient and reliable solutions for uneven surfaces.


Preventative Actions to Stay Clear Of Future Irregular Surfaces



Several property owners neglect preventative measures that can aid keep a level surface area in time. Regularly evaluating the concrete for cracks and cracks is crucial, as very early discovery can prevent a lot more major issues. Guaranteeing correct drainage around the building is likewise vital; water pooling near concrete can result in erosion and settling. House owners must think about utilizing landscaping methods, such as sloping soil away from concrete surface areas, to even more minimize water-related damage. In addition, using a high-quality sealant can protect against dampness infiltration and freeze-thaw cycles. Avoiding extreme weight on concrete surface areas, specifically during building and construction or renovation, can stop early settling. By applying these actions, home owners can substantially lower the threat of future unequal surfaces
